HB 2474 Summary

  • Amends Arizona Revised Statutes Section 16-803 regarding new political party recognition petitions filed with the secretary of state or county/city/town election officers at least 250 days before a primary election.

  • Invalidates any signature sheet on a new party petition containing signatures collected more than 24 months before the primary election for which the party seeks recognition, requiring the filing officer to remove such sheets.

  • Changes language from "receipt of" to "receiving" and "per cent" to "percent" for technical corrections throughout the signature verification process.

  • Maintains existing procedures for secretary of state review of petitions, random sampling of signatures for verification by county recorders, and calculation of valid signatures to determine party recognition eligibility.

  • Designated as an emergency measure operative immediately upon approval, signed by the Governor on April 10, 2024.
